At the end of their annual convention in Atlantic City last week, U. S. dentists were as ignorant as ever of the cause of decayed teeth. Three explanations went the rounds: dirty mouths, improper food, unbalanced endocrine glands. None or all give the complete answer, according to the most conscientious research minds of the American Dental Association, 10,000 of whose 40,000 members attended the convention.
